To do your own lawn care in Huntersville, NC, you’ll need a few basic tools. These include a lawn mower, a watering system, a fertilizer spreader, and a weed killer. Here are some specific tools you may want to consider:
- Lawn mower: A lawn mower is the most essential tool for maintaining your lawn. Choose a mower that is appropriate for the size and type of grass in your yard. For example, a push mower may be suitable for a small lawn, while a riding mower may be better for a larger lawn.
- Watering system: A watering system, such as a hose or a sprinkler, is essential for providing your lawn with the water it needs to grow and thrive. Choose a watering system that is easy to use and covers your entire lawn evenly.
- Fertilizer spreader: A fertilizer spreader makes it easy to apply fertilizer to your lawn evenly and efficiently. Choose a spreader that is appropriate for the size of your lawn and the type of fertilizer you plan to use.
- Weed killer: A weed killer is a key tool for controlling weeds in your lawn. Choose a weed killer that is appropriate for the type of weeds you have and the type of grass in your lawn. Be sure to read and follow the manufacturer’s instructions carefully when applying weed killer to your lawn.
In addition to these basic tools, you may also want to consider some optional tools, such as a rake for removing debris, a lawn aerator for improving the health of your soil, and a grass trimmer for edging along sidewalks and other areas. By having the right tools, you can effectively maintain your lawn and keep it looking its best.

Things to Consider when Doing Your Own Lawn Care in Huntersville, North Carolina

- Know your lawn’s needs: Before you can get started with your lawn care, you need to know what your lawn needs. Different grasses require different levels of care, so it’s important to know what type of grass you have and what it needs to stay healthy.
- Choose the right tools: Having the right tools is essential for keeping your lawn in top shape. You’ll need a lawn mower, a rake, a shovel, and other tools. Make sure you have the right tools for the job before you start.
- Choose the right fertilizer: Choose a fertilizer that’s right for your grass type and follow the directions carefully. Too much fertilizer can be harmful to your grass and can even kill it.
- Water your lawn correctly: Make sure you’re watering your lawn correctly. Too much or too little water can both be bad for your lawn. It’s important to water your lawn deeply and infrequently for the best results.
- Mow your lawn properly: Mow your lawn regularly and at the right height. Mowing too frequently or too low can be bad for your lawn. Make sure you’re mowing your lawn at the right height for your grass type.
- Know when to call a professional: If you’re having problems with your lawn, it may be time to call a professional. A lawn care expert can help you diagnose any problems and find a solution.
